COCONUT CRUNCH COOKIES



Coconut Crunch Cookies image

These sweet drop cookies are loaded with coconut and chocolate chips. Their crisp edges and soft centers add up to a perfect cookie.-Maria Regakis, Somerville, Massachusetts

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 40m

Yield about 4-1/2 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 cup butter, softened
3/4 cup sugar
3/4 cup packed brown sugar
2 eggs
2 teaspoons vanilla extract
1 teaspoon almond extract
2 cups all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king soda
3/4 teaspoon salt
2 cups sweetened shredded coconut
1 package (11-1/2 ounces) milk chocolate chips
1-1/2 cups finely chopped almonds

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, cream butter and sugars until light and fluffy. Beat in eggs and extracts. Combine the flour, baking soda and salt; gradually add to creamed mixture and mix well. Stir in the coconut, chocolate chips and almonds. , Drop by rounded teaspoonfuls 2 in. apart onto ungreased baking sheets. Bake at 375° for 9-11 minutes or until lightly browned. Cool for 1 minute before removing from pans to wire racks.

COCONUT BANANA COOKIES



Coconut Banana Cookies image

This is a springtime variation on my grandma's banana drop cookies and, with tons of coconut flavor, it's perfect for Easter. -Elyse Benner, Solon, Ohio

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 35m

Yield about 1-1/2 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 11

1/2 cup shortening, room temperature
1/4 cup creamy cashew butter
1 cup sugar
1 cup mashed ripe banana (about 2 medium)
1 large egg, room temperature
1 tablespoon grated lime zest
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1-3/4 cups unsweetened finely shredded coconut
1-1/2 cups all-purpose flour
1/2 cup sweetened flaked coconut

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375°. Cream shortening, cashew butter and sugar until light and fluffy, 5-7 minutes. Beat in next 5 ingredients until thoroughly mixed. In a separate bowl, mix unsweetened coconut and flour. Beat into creamed mixture just until combined., Using a medium cookie scoop, drop dough 2 in. apart onto parchment-lined baking sheets. Sprinkle with sweetened coconut. Bake until edges are golden brown, 15-20 minutes (cookies will have cakelike texture). Remove from pans to wire racks to cool. Serve warm or at room temperature.

COCONUT BANANA COOKIES



Coconut Banana Cookies image

These banana cookies made with coconut oil are soft and mildly sweet with a subtle coconut flavor. My son likes them with raspberry jam on top.

Provided by cookinDadda

Categories     Desserts     Fruit Dessert Recipes     Banana Dessert Recipes

Time 50m

Yield 24

Number Of Ingredients 9

2 teaspoons coconut oil, or as needed
½ cup twice-sifted coconut flour
1 teaspoon cream of tartar
½ teaspoon baking soda
¼ teaspoon sea salt
1 ⅓ cups mashed ripe bananas
3 large eggs
⅓ cup extra-virgin coconut oil, warmed slightly
1 tablespoon vanilla extract

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 300 degrees F (150 degrees C) using the convection setting. Grease 2 cookie sheets with 1 teaspoon coconut oil each.
  • Mix coconut flour, cream of tartar, baking soda, and salt together in a small bowl.
  • Combine mashed bananas, eggs, 1/3 cup coconut oil, and vanilla extract in a separate bowl. Beat with an electric mixer until creamy. Slowly add the flour mixture while continuing to mix.
  • Drop spoonfuls of cookie dough onto the greased cookie sheets. Flatten cookies using the back of the spoon.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until no longer wet, about 35 minutes.

CARAMELIZED BANANAS WITH PECAN-COCONUT CRUNCH



Caramelized Bananas With Pecan-Coconut Crunch image

This cozy dessert comes together quickly and fills the kitchen with a sweet, buttery aroma. The textures play well together: The spiced caramel is silky but robust, the bananas tender, and the pecan-and-coconut topping crunchy and crisp. Pick ripe but firm bananas so they'll maintain their shape after cooking. (The bananas should be yellow with no black spots; green bananas won't work.) Broil them until sizzling, then allow the bubbling caramel to cool and thicken a bit before serving. Devoured directly out of the skillet, or spooned into individual servings, these caramelized bananas are a lovely way to end a meal. Top with a scoop of ice cream for a cool contrast to the warm dessert.

Provided by Yewande Komolafe

Categories     snack, ice creams and sorbets, dessert

Time 25m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 14

4 tablespoons/55 grams unsalted butter (1/2 stick)
2 tablespoons honey
1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
1/2 cup/50 grams shelled pecans, chopped
1/4 cup/35 grams raw pumpkin seeds
1/4 cup/20 grams rolled oats
1/4 cup/20 grams large coconut chips or flakes
2 tablespoons sesame seeds, flax seeds, chia seeds or any other small seed
1/4 cup plus 2 tablespoons/85 grams dark brown sugar
1/4 cup/60 milliliters heavy cream
Pinch of nutmeg
Pinch of black pepper
4 to 5 ripe but firm bananas (about 1 3/4 pounds/795 grams), peeled and halved lengthwise
Ice cream, whipped cream or crème fraîche, for serving

Steps:

  • Make the crunchy topping: In a large skillet, heat 2 tablespoons butter over medium until melted and foamy, about 3 minutes. Add 1 tablespoon honey and the salt; using a spatula, stir to combine. Add the pecans, pumpkin seeds, oats and coconut and stir to coat. Toast, stirring frequently, until the mixture is golden brown, about 8 minutes, lowering the heat as necessary to keep the mixture from burning. Stir in the sesame seeds and remove from heat. Move to a shallow bowl and set aside to cool. (You should have about 1 1/2 cups.)
  • Prepare the bananas: Set the oven to broil. Wipe out the skillet and add the brown sugar, heavy cream, nutmeg, pepper, remaining 2 tablespoons butter and 1 tablespoon honey. Stir ingredients and bring to a simmer over medium heat until the sugar is dissolved, about 2 minutes.
  • Remove the skillet from the heat and place the bananas in the pan, cut-side up. Spoon some of the sauce over the top to coat the slices. Move the pan to the oven and broil until the caramel sauce is hot and bubbly and the bananas are tender, deep golden and slightly charred in spots, 7 to 10 minutes. Remove from oven and allow to sit for at least 5 minutes.
  • Spoon a large helping of the ice cream, whipped cream or crème fraîche over the warm bananas, then scatter the pecan-coconut crunch over the top. Divide among individual plates or eat directly from the skillet.

BANANA COCONUT CRUNCH CAKE



Banana Coconut Crunch Cake image

Categories     Cake     Rum     Fruit     Dessert     Bake     Cream Cheese     Banana     Coconut     Spring     Gourmet     Kidney Friendly     Vegetarian     Pescatarian     Peanut Free     Tree Nut Free     Soy Free     Kosher

Yield Serves 6 to 8

Number Of Ingredients 22

For cake layer
1/2 cup sweetened flaked coconut
1 cup cake flour (not self-rising)
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1/4 teaspoon baking powder
1/8 teaspoon salt
2 large eggs
1/2 cup mashed banana (about 1 large)
3 tablespoons crème fraîche or sour cream
1/2 teaspoon vanilla
3/4 stick (6 tablespoons) unsalted butter, softened
1/2 cup granulated sugar
For rum syrup
1/4 cup water
2 tablespoons granulated sugar
2 tablespoons dark rum
For frosting
1/2 pound cream cheese, softened
1/2 stick (1/4 cup) unsalted butter, softened
1 1/2 cups confectioners' sugar, sifted
1 teaspoon vanilla
2/3 cup crisp banana chips

Steps:

  • Make cake layer:
  • Preheat oven to 350°F. Butter an 8-inch square, 2-inch deep baking pan and line bottom with wax paper. Butter paper and dust with flour, knocking out excess flour.
  • On a baking sheet toast coconut in the middle of the oven, stirring once, until golden, about 6 minutes.
  • Into a bowl sift together flour, baking soda, baking powder, and salt. In a small bowl whisk together eggs, bananas, crème fraîche or sour cream, and vanilla.
  • In a bowl of a standing electric mixer beat together butter and sugar until light and fluffy. Beat in flour and egg mixtures alternately, beginning and ending with flour mixture and beating after each addition until batter is smooth, and fold in coconut.
  • Turn batter into pan, smoothing top, and bake in middle of oven until a tester inserted into center comes out clean, about 30 minutes. Cool cake in pan on rack 10 minutes. Run a thin knife around edges of pan and invert cake onto rack. Remove wax paper carefully and cool cake completely. Cake layer may be made 3 days ahead and chilled, wrapped in plastic wrap and foil.
  • Make syrup:
  • In a small saucepan bring water and sugar to a boil over moderate heat, stirring until sugar is dissolved, and simmer 1 minute. Stir in rum and simmer 1 minute. Cool syrup completely. Syrup may be made 3 days ahead and chilled, covered.
  • Make frosting:
  • In a bowl with an electric mixer beat together cream cheese and butter until light and fluffy. Add confectioners' sugar, 1/2 cup at a time, beating well after each addition, and beat in vanilla and pinch salt. In a food processor coarsely grind banana chips and stir into frosting.
  • With serrated knife halve cake layer horizontally and with pastry brush dab cut sides with rum syrup, using it all. Spread half of frosting on cut side of bottom layer and arrange top layer, cut side down, on frosting. Spread remaining frosting on top of cake. Cake may be assembled 3 hours ahead and chilled, covered with an overturned bowl or in a cake keeper.
